Cheryl Bear Concert for She Matters 4

Canadian Baptist Ministries (CBM) and Altadore Baptist Church are pleased to host a free concert featuring Cheryl Bear, as part of the CBM She Matters 4 Canada Learning Tour. She Matters 4 Canada opens difficult dialogue on issues facing Indigenous women today, such as discrimination, marginalization, and the often taboo subject of gender-based violence, that only increases with silence and denial. In Canada, Aboriginal women are killed at six times the rate of non-aboriginal women. Many have simply gone missing. CBM has invited singer/songwriter and Indigenous leader Cheryl Bear from the Nadleh Whut’en community in Northern British Columbia to be their She Matters spokesperson for 2017-18. Cheryl is an award-winning performer and educator who shares stories of Indigenous life – the joy, sorrow, faith and journey. There is no charge to attend but donations to She Matters 4 will be gratefully accepted.
